Abstract
The coordination geometry of the metal centre can be controlled by the ligand design. Especially, the ortho-substituents of the phenolate moieties as well as the nature of side-arm donor influence the structure and reactivity of the complexes formed. Depending on the metal ion and the ligand environment, the complexes formed can be monomeric or dimeric ones. Several heterobimetallic complexes are also known. (c) 2011 Elsevier B.V.
